The simple economics of utilizing proprietary software vendors for private cloud management has forced enterprises to explore other options.

One strategy enterprises can adopt in order to reduce infrastructure costs is to move to open source platforms. This allows organizations to not only rein in costs, but also to gain more control over their infrastructure.

This paper explores migrating to an open source cloud computing platform - OpenStack - and compares it with vRealize - the proprietary virtualization platform from VMware.
